Fries (Mobile UI framework)는 div scroll 지원되지 않는 브라우저에 대한 호환을 위한 지원계획이 없기에 직접 패치작업 진행.overthrow 써보니 android 2.x등 모두 지원하지만뻑뻑한 스크롤만 지원됨.하여 NiceScroll (http://areaaperta.com/nicescroll/) 발견 후 적용해보니 동적으로 로딩되어 높이가 변하면 문제 생기길래 iScroll 등 다른것 찾아보다가 stack overflow 답변을 통해$(obj).getNiceScroll().resize() 발견 후메뉴얼을 다시금 확인 후동적으로 내용을 변경하게 하는 부분들의 끝부분마다 전부 적용해보니말끔하게 작동하는 스크롤을 확인할 수 있었음.
주말, 간단히 두뇌 예열 겸 간단한거 하나.아래와 같은 모바일웹 이벤트 페이지는 어떻게 구성되었는지 분석해 본다. 이미지의 가로 사이즈는 800px 이었다. 아래 스샷은 스크린이 이미지 가로 사이즈보다 넓은 950px 에서의 뷰이며 양쪽 여백이 생기며 가로 정렬 되어 있음을 알 수 있다. 이미지들은 어떻게 잘라서 구성하였나? TOP 이미지 본문 버튼 본문 하단 SNS 아이콘 버튼들 SNS 아이콘버튼들 구성 소스 각 -1){$("#____kakaolink____").attr("src","https://itunes.apple.com/kr/app/kakaotog-kakaotalk/id362057947?mt=8");}}},1500);$("#____kakaolink____").attr("src",this.data..
http://jquerymobile.com/blog/2013/01/14/announcing-jquery-mobile-1-3-0-beta/ 영어 전문가가 아니기에 발번역했습니다. 교정은 받고 악플은 반사합니다.1. (기기) 응답형 디자인 지원. 태블릿 등에서도 잘 지원이 되도록 하려나 봅니다. 그리드, 테이블에 대해 응답형 디자인을 지원해주네요.2. 사이드 패널 위젯 [새창] 페이스북 모바일버젼에서 좌측 상단의 버튼을 누르면 왼쪽에서 오른쪽으로 스스륵 나오며 보여지는 메뉴들이 담긴 패널을 지원하게 되었습니다. 좌,우측 모두 가능하며 에니메이션도 3가지를 지원하는군요.3. 범위 슬라이더 기존 슬라이더 입력 요소는 하나의 수치만 입력 가능했는데 이제 어디~어디까지의 두 시작과 종료 수치를 시각적으로 편하게 입..
데모 (가능한것들) : (모바일 브라우저에서는 http://lungojs.tapquo.com/의 주소로 접근하시면 됩니다.) jQuery Mobile, Sencha Touch2 로 개발을 경험해 보았는데 2012 현재 시점으로 한국에서 가장 많이 사용되고 있는 Android 2.x 버젼대에서 모두 트랜지션 효과에서 문제가 발생하였습니다. 이거 IE6 호환 개발 문제 만큼 멘붕일으킵니다. (iOS는 무조건 잘 동작하므로 실험에서 제외) 대안을 찾다가 발견한것이 - 진도 모바일 (무료 GPL) - Kendo Mobile (유료) - iUI (무료 MIT 라이센스) - LungoJS (무료 GPL) 입니다. 진도 모바일은 호환성이 뛰어나 모든 기기에서 너무도 잘 작동하며 속도도 좋습니다. 하지만 기본적인 버튼..
jQueryMobile .ui-page { -webkit-backface-visibility: hidden; } $(document).bind("mobileinit", function() { if (navigator.userAgent.indexOf("Android") != -1) { $.mobile.defaultPageTransition = 'none'; $.mobile.defaultDialogTransition = 'none'; } }); 출처 링크 SenchaTouch 2 .x-panel { -webkit-perspective: 1000; -webkit-backface-visibility: hidden; } 출처 링크
Phonegap 사이트에서 다운받고 압축을 해제하면 설치 패키지는 보이지 않고 폴더와 일반 파일들만 보인다. 설치 패키지는 lib 폴더 하위의 각 모바일운영체제 폴더 안에 있다. iOS의 경우 기존 phonegap-x.x.x.dmg 라는것에서 Cordova-1.7.0.dmg 와 같이 이름이 변경되어 있다. 여튼, 열려있는 Xcode가 있다면 Cmd + Q 하여 종료시키고 설치패키지를 더블클릭하여 설치하고 Xcode를 실행 > Cmd + Shift + N 하면 Cordova-Based Application 가 보인다. 그것을 선택하여 프로젝트를 시작한다. 프로젝트가 열리면 프로젝트에 Contrl + 클릭 > Show In Finder 로 파인더를 연 후 www 폴더를 Xcode의 프로젝트명으로 (프로젝트 ..
영어 가능하신 분들을 위한 원문 = http://www.stokkers.mobi/valuables/bartender.html 원작자의 Github에서 소스를 다운받고 작업할 디렉토리에 압축 해제해 주세요. 1. 아이콘 작업 다소의 포토샵 스킬이 필요합니다. 작업 전에 sprite_combined.png 파일을 잘 보십시오. 다운받은 소스의 압축을 풀어보면 templates 디렉토리가 있습니다. 그 아래에 탭바의 재료가 되는 포토샵(*.PSD) 파일이 존재하는데 templates_double.psd 를 포토샵으로 열고 가이드를 보이게(Ctrl + ;) 하면 원작자가 새겨놓은 가이드가 보일겁니다. 위에서 잘 보라고 해 두었던 sprite_combined.png 파일을 보면 아이콘이 위, 아래로 있습니다. 위..
Sencha Touch2 MVC 코딩중... /theApp/app/view/etc.js Ext.define('theApp.view.etc', { extend: 'Ext.List', requires: [ ' theApp.view.etc.ListItem.js' ] ...... }); 했더니 Ext.createByAlias Cannot create an instance of unrecognized alias 오류를 받았다. 해결은? 위 코드에서 etc와 etc는 달라야 한다. 아래와 같이 변경해서 해결하였다. ListItem.js 가 있는 폴더의 이름을 etc 에서 Etc 로 변경하였다. (자바스크립트는 대소문자를 구분한다.) Ext.define('theApp.view.etc', { extend: 'Ext.L..
MVC 환경에서 [WARN][Anonymous] [Ext.Loader] Synchronously loading 'app.view.Viewport'; consider adding 'app.view.Viewport' explicitly as a require of the corresponding class 오류 발생시 아래와 같이 views: 에 추가하니 사라졌다. Ext.application({ views: [ 'Viewport' ] }); 다른 이유와 해결법이 발생하면 추가예정.
- Total
- Today
- Yesterday
- Make Use Of
- How to geek
- 인터넷 통계정보 검색시스템
- 트위터 공유 정보모음
- 웹표준KR
- 치우의 컴맹탈출구
- Dev. Cheat Sheets
- w3schools
- Dev. 조각들
- ASP Ajax Library
- CSS Tricks
- WebResourcesDepot
- jQuery Selectors Tester
- DeveloperSnippets
- Smashing Magazine
- Nettuts+
- devListing
- 웹 리소스 사이트(한)
- Mobile tuts+
- Dream In Code
- Developer Tutorials
- CSS3 Previews
- 자북
- 안드로이드 사이드
- Code Visually
- Code School
- SQLer.com
- 무료 파워포인트 템플릿
- iconPot
- Free PowerPoint Templates
- Design Bombs
- Web Designer Wall
- 1st Webdesigner
- Vandelay Design
- 무료 벡터 이미지 사이트들
- Tripwire Magazine
- Web TrendSet
- WebMonkey
- 윤춘근 프리젠테이션 디자이너 블로그
- cz.cc 무료 DNS
- [웹하드] MediaFire
- [웹하드] DivShare
- 한컴 인터넷 오피스
- git
- Wordpress
- CSS
- 한글
- mssql
- Android
- laravel
- iis
- PHP
- javascript
- Prototype
- classic asp
- JQuery
- 안드로이드
- IE
- 워드프레스
- Docker
- API
- Linux
- Debug
- nginx
- iphone
- centos
- Mac
- IOS
- nodejs
- JSON
- sencha touch
- Chrome
- ASP
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|